Maputo vs Trier-Petrisberg Climate & Distance Between

Germany flag
  • The distance between Maputo, Mozambique and Trier-Petrisberg, Germany is approximately 8,795 km or 5,465 mi.
  • To reach Maputo in this distance one would set out from Trier-Petrisberg bearing 156.4° or SSE and follow the great circles arc to approach Maputo bearing 163.3° or SSE .
  • Maputo has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Trier-Petrisberg has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
  • Maputo is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ome whereas Trier-Petrisberg is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 13.9 °C (25.1°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 10.2 °C (18.4°F) less in Maputo.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 15 mm (0.6 in) less which is equivalent to 15 l/m² (0.37 US gal/ft²) or 150,000 l/ha (16,036 US gal/ac) less. About 1 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 23° higher in Maputo than in Trier-Petrisberg.
